 
        
        We are seeking a highly skilled software engineering specialist to join our team in ciudad de méxico. The ideal candidate will have a strong analytical mindset, excellent communication skills, and a passion for learning.
 * 3+ years of proven experience as a software engineer or similar role
 * expertise in developing and consuming apis, web services development (rest), software design, object-oriented development methodologies, relational and nosql databases, cloud computing (azure preferred), agile and waterfall delivery methodologies, design patterns, and solid principles
 * bachelor's degree or equivalent experience
 * english level c1 or above (required)
 * jquery (expert level), express js, next js, relational databases (sql/mysql, nosql, postgres, db2, mongodb), microsoft 365 (teams, sharepoint, exchange), powershell scripting (desirable), microsoft authentication library (desirable)
 * excellent technical authoring skills, strong analytical and documentation skills, strong powerpoint and presentation skills
 * motivated self-starter, can-do attitude, personable and professional manner, methodical, diligent approach to problem solving, good organizing skills, willingness to develop new skills and take on new challenges, ability to work in a team, good inter-personal skills, punctual, understanding of business-critical deadlines and dependencies, excellent written and verbal communication skills, ability to work effectively under pressure, ability to communicate with all levels of management, collaborative style that promotes teamwork